POTENTIAL HEALTH EFFECTS

Likely Routes of Exposure: Skin contact and inhalation

EYE CONTACT: No more than slightly irritating based on toxicity studies of a similar material.
The dry powder may cause foreign body irritation in some individuals.

SKIN CONTACT: No more than slightly toxic or slightly irritating based on toxicity studies of a
similar material. Prolonged contact with the dry powder may cause drying or chapping of the
skin.

INHALATION: This product may cause coughing, chest tightness, runny nose, chest pain, and
burning throat based on a similar material.

INGESTION: No more than slightly toxic if swallowed based on toxicity tests of a similar material.
No significant adverse health effects are expected to develop if only small amounts (less than a
mouthful) are swallowed. Swallowing large quantities may cause gastrointestinal tract irritation,
n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ea.

Refer to Section 11 for toxicological information.

4. FIRST AID MEASURES

IF IN EYES OR ON SKIN, immediate first aid is not likely to be required. However, this material
can be removed with water. Remove material from eyes, skin and clothing. Wash heavily
contaminated clothing before reuse.

IF INHALED, remove to fresh air. If not breathing, give artificial respiration. If breathing is
difficult, give oxygen.

IF SWALLOWED, immediate first aid is not likely to be required. A physician or Poison Control
Center can be contacted for advice.

AIRBORNE EXPOSURE LIMITS: OSHA and ACGIH have not established specific exposure
limits for this material. However, OSHA and ACGIH have established limits for particulates not
otherwise classified (PNOC) which are the least stringent exposure limits applicable to dusts.

OSHA PEL ACGIH TLV
15 mg/m3 (total dust) 8-hr TWA 10 mg/m3 (inhalable) 8-hr TWA
5 mg/m3 (respirable) 8-hr TWA 3 mg/m3 (respirable) 8-hr TWA

9. PHYSICAL AND CHEMICAL PROPERTIES

Chemical Formula: Na5P3O10 .6H2O
Appearance: White powder or granules
Odor: None
pH: 10 (as a 1% solution @ 25 C)
Melting Point @ 760 mm Hg: Begins to decompose @ 70 degrees C;
Solubility in Water (g/100 g H2O): 16 @ 25 degrees C,

11. T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ION

ICL Performance Products LP has not conducted any toxicological studies on this material.
However, data from ICL Performance Products LP single-dose (acute) animal studies with
sodium tripolyphosphate anhydrous, a similar material, are given below:

Oral - rat LD50 - 5,400 mg/kg; practically non-toxic
Dermal - rabbit LD50 - > 7,940 mg/kg; practically non-toxic
Eye Irritation - rabbit - 3.3/110.0; slightly irritating
Skin Irritation - rabbit - 0-0/8.0 (24-hr exp.); not irritating
Inhalation - LC50 > 0.39 mg/L (rat, 4 hr) (maximum attainable concentration)

Rats fed Sodium Tripolyphosphate Anhydrous in their diet for two years exhibited decreased
growth, increased kidney/body weight ratios, and kidney changes. No birth defects were noted in
rabbits given Sodium Tripolyphosphate Anhydrous orally during pregnancy. No effects were
seen on the ability of male and female rats to reproduce when fed Sodium Tripolyphosphate

Anhydrous for 3 successive generations. Sodium Tripolyphosphate Anhydrous has generally
produced no genetic changes in a variety of standard tests using animals and animal or bacterial
cells. Genetic changes were reported in a standard test using yeast cells.

12. ECOLOGICAL INFORMATION

ICL Performance Products LP has not conducted any environmental studies with this material.
However, data for a sodium tripolyphosphate anhydrous, a similar material, are presented below.

Invertebrate: 48-hr EC50 Daphnia magna: > 1000 mg/L; Practically Nontoxic

96 hr. LC 50 > 100 mg/L, non-toxic (Rainbow trout, Inland silversides and mysid schrimp). [FMC
I89-1081, 1082 & 1083]

48 hr. EC 50> 100 mg/L, non-toxic (Daphnia magna) [FMC I89-1084]

ICL Performance Products LP has not conducted biodegradation studies with this product since
when dissolved/hydrolyzed in water it yields completely mineralized materials.
